Michael Ryan 1836 – 1913 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1836

Birth Location: Doon, Limerick, Ireland

Death Date: 18 Aug 1913

Death Location: Clinton County, New York

Father: James Ryan

Mother: Mary Bourke

Spouse(s): Mary Ryan

Children(s): Annie Ryan, Mary Ryan

1836 marked the beginning of Michael Ryan's life in Doon, Limerick, Ireland, to parents James Ryan and Mary Bourke. Eventually, Michael Ryan married Mary Ryan, and they welcomed Annie Ryan and Mary Ryan. Michael Ryan passed in 1913 at Clinton County, New York.
